Exactech Innovations Presented at
International Scientific Conference
Exactech, Inc. (Nasdaq: EXAC), a developer and producer of bone
and joint restoration products for hip, knee, shoulder and spine,
today reported that studies involving its knee and shoulder joint
replacement innovations and its ExactechGPS® guided personalized
surgery system were featured at the 29th Congress of The
International Society for Technology in Arthroplasty (ISTA) in
Boston, Massachusetts.
The studies presented by orthopaedic surgeons and Exactech
engineers and scientists included a presentation, “Benefit of
Modern Navigation System in Total Knee Arthroplasty" by Jung-Dong
Chang, MD, PhD, who was honored as an ISTA Invited Faculty member
from South Korea. His study of 272 total knee replacement surgeries
using the Optetrak Logic® knee system, supported by the ExactechGPS
computer-assisted surgery system, demonstrated accurate and
reproducible results in terms of joint implant alignment and
implant position.

About ISTA
The International Society for Technology in Arthroplasty (ISTA)
is a nonprofit corporation whose goal is to promote public
awareness, education and research, in arthroplasty. The means by
which this purpose is achieved is through ISTA’s Annual Congress
where emerging technologies are discussed between surgeons,
engineers, and industry.
About Exactech
Based in Gainesville, Fla., Exactech develops and markets
orthopaedic implant devices, related surgical instruments and
biologic materials and services to hospitals and physicians. The
company manufactures many of its orthopaedic devices at its
Gainesville facility. Exactech’s orthopaedic products are used in
the restoration of bones and joints that have deteriorated as a
result of injury or diseases such as arthritis. Exactech markets
its products in the United States, in addition to more than 30
markets in Europe, Latin America, Asia and the Pacific. Additional
